Measuring up: Benchmarking in the UK medical research charity sector

In May 2018 we circulated a survey of 50 questions to our member charity CEOs and formal representatives. This resulting report is the first of its kind, providing UK medical research charities with crucial benchmarking data to inform the management of their organisations and staff.

Any organisation can only be as good as the people it recruits. Staffing decisions are among the most important that charities make. Over recent years, employment law has become increasingly wide-ranging and ever more complex - subject to constant change. Consequently, our member charities need to take a proactive approach to managing their employees and the working environment.

Key findings

  • When asked about their top challenge for the upcoming year, 57% of responding charities said either retention, recruitment or both.

What do you see as your one biggest HR challenge for the next 12 months?

This was an open answer question so respondents could write what they wished. Note that not all charities answered this question (35/48) and those that did often gave more than one answer.
